Hey Priya — handing over the Quillbase static-analysis setup. Heads up: the baseline file (`sa-baseline.yml`) suppresses about 140 legacy findings so new PRs stay clean. Don't let anyone add fresh suppressions without a ticket — that's the whole game. I've been burning down roughly ten entries a sprint. The suppression policy and the burn-down tracker are on the page below.

runbook for fajep-yahop: https://rundeck.braskdata.example/repo/run/pages/job/dfe5b8c563356906

Subject: PingFawn cut-over complete

Team,

PingFawn (deploy-status bot) is now fully cut over to the new event bus. Old webhook listeners are disabled, not deleted; remove them next sprint. Alert routing unchanged. Latency on status posts dropped noticeably. If rollback is ever needed, restore the listener set first. Production now runs with the following configuration.

service settings:
[casax]
port = 6379
team = rusir
host = casax.zemvarhq.corp
region = outer-4
access_code = ac_9808ce
timeout_ms = 1500

For this week's sync: the Pointsmith ledger treats every points grant and redemption as an append-only entry, and nightly reconciliation compares ledger totals against the member balance cache. If the drift counter exceeds the tolerance, the reconciler halts rather than auto-correcting, and a manual review is required before reopening redemptions. Do not restart the service to clear the halt — that masks the discrepancy without resolving it. The reconciler's thresholds and retry behavior are governed by the configuration below.

service settings:
quenath:
  log_level: info
  metrics_host: metrics.quenath.tolvaqlabs.internal
  pin: 1407
  pool_size: 8

Welcome to the Torvane platform team. Every node behind our Ridgeline load balancer answers health probes with a provenance payload, not just a 200. This lets us confirm that the running binary matches what CI actually produced, rather than trusting the deploy log. When a probe fails, compare the reported artifact digest against the registry entry before draining the node. New joiners should practice this on the sandbox cluster first. For reference, the current sandbox build token is listed below.

session token of kageg-tahop = htk14_af3c1ccccb7dcf